I’m pretty sure this was the first gag cartoon set in a courtroom that I ever drew. Court scenes are a common trope in gag cartoons. We’re all at least somewhat familiar with basic ideas about courts and trials, probably most of us from TV and movies, though some of us may have had the dutiful displeasure of being on jury duty or being in a trial. So they can make for good fodder to screw around with in a cartoon.
More than likely I came up with the idea for this cartoon by using my handy list of common tropes. It’s basically a combination of two unrelated tropes smooshed together. Put The Wizard of Oz and a courtroom together and what do you get? Let your brain meander around that for a while and it doesn’t take long to get to the idea that Dorothy‘s house killed the witch and so, I’m guessing that would probably be considered manslaughter? And Thus, Dorothy finds herself on trial.
